logo

模型融合:提升预测能力的强大工具

作者:谁偷走了我的奶酪2024.02.16 01:51浏览量:22

简介:模型融合是一种通过结合多个模型的预测结果来提高整体预测精度的技术。它克服了单一模型的局限性,并通过集成多个模型的优势来提升预测性能。本文将深入探讨模型融合的原理、方法、优势以及应用场景。

机器学习和数据分析领域,模型融合作为一种强大的技术手段,正逐渐受到广泛关注。模型融合,也称为集成学习,并不是指具体的某一个算法,而是一种将多个弱模型合并为一个强模型的思想。通过结合多个模型的预测结果,模型融合旨在提高整体预测精度和泛化能力。

模型融合的实现方式多种多样,其中包括Bagging、Boosting等思想的方法。Bagging是一种通过重采样技术生成多个子数据集,并在这些子数据集上训练多个基模型的方法。Boosting则是一种通过加权平均多个基模型的预测结果来提高预测精度的技术。

模型融合的应用广泛,其优势主要体现在以下几个方面:

  1. 提高预测精度:通过结合多个模型的预测结果,模型融合可以有效提高整体预测精度。
  2. 降低过拟合风险:单一模型容易受到过拟合的影响,而模型融合可以通过集成多个模型的优点来降低过拟合风险。
  3. 提高鲁棒性:不同的模型对不同的数据集和特征具有不同的敏感性,通过集成这些模型的预测结果,可以提高模型的鲁棒性。
  4. 简化模型选择:在多个模型中,有些可能对训练数据过度拟合,而有些可能对测试数据表现不佳。通过模型融合,可以自动选择表现最佳的模型组合,从而简化模型选择过程。

在实际应用中,模型融合的应用场景非常广泛。例如,在自然语言处理领域,可以使用基于词袋模型的Bagging方法来提高文本分类的准确率;在图像识别领域,可以使用基于神经网络的Boosting方法来提高图像分类的精度。此外,在金融、医疗、交通等领域,模型融合也得到了广泛应用。

值得注意的是,模型融合并不总是能够提高预测性能。其效果取决于个体学习器的准确性和多样性。一般来说,个体学习器准确性越高、多样性越大,则融合效果越好。因此,在应用模型融合时,需要仔细选择和调整个体学习器,以确保最佳的预测性能。

此外,为了实现高效的模型融合,还需要注意个体学习器的训练方式和融合策略的选择。例如,可以使用随机森林或梯度提升机等算法来训练个体学习器,并采用加权平均或投票等方式来融合它们的预测结果。

总之,模型融合作为一种强大的技术手段,在提高预测精度、降低过拟合风险、提高鲁棒性和简化模型选择等方面具有显著优势。随着机器学习和数据分析技术的不断发展,相信模型融合将在更多领域得到广泛应用和深入应用。

相关文章推荐

发表评论

活动